3.4 EEPROM
The EEPROM stores data such as the total page count, BJ cartridge installation/removal count, total waste ink amount, and customsettings. The page count and waste ink amount indicate the frequency with which the printer is used. The EEPROM must be reset when the logic board, EEPROM, or waste ink absorbers are replaced. 3.5 Cleaning the BJ Cartridge
If the printed page shows faults such as white lines or fragmentation, print a nozzle check pattern to see if the print head nozzles are clogged. If they are, operate cleaning function for the BJ cartridge to clear the nozzles, as described below.

Manual Print Head Cleaning
1)With the printer power ON, press the RESUME button until the beeper sounds once.
2)The POWER indicator blinks. (Any paper in the printer is ejected.)
3)Both BJ cartridges installed in the printer are cleaned.
4)On completion of cleaning, the beeper sounds and the POWER indicator lights continuously.
Deep Cleaning
If after performing normal cleaning, the print quality is still not satisfactory, perform deep cleaning.
Deep cleaning uses more ink than normal cleaning.
1)With the printer power ON, press the RESUME button until the beeper sounds twice.
2)The POWER indicator blinks. (Any paper in the printer is ejected.)
3)Both BJ cartridges installed in the printer are deep cleaned.
4)On completion of deep cleaning, the beeper sounds and the POWER indicator lights continuously.
